Significantly longer turnaround times for semiconductor equipment

 

At the moment, the global chip shortage corresponds to the news of semiconductor equipment delivery time extensions are also on the rise.


According to industry practitioners, the semiconductor test ATE equipment delivery time is now generally more than 6 months, the more sought-after test equipment orders have been scheduled for 2024. Not only the ATE equipment, but the delivery time of the probe table is also generally more than 12 months. This is mainly due to the mainstream machines are produced in Japan, its conservative and robust production methods, resulting in its production being far from keeping up with market demand.


Semiconductor test equipment manufacturer Edelman test Taiwan chairman and general manager, Wu Wankun said recently, by the strong demand for logic chips, Edelman this year, chip automation testing equipment hit the best ever to receive orders. But also by the chip and part of the shortage of raw materials, the equipment delivery period lengthened to at least six months or more. He also stressed that the impact of rising costs, the company does not rule out the new year to raise the price of test equipment.

 

The semiconductor equipment leading application materials are also said by the shortage of parts and other issues. According to the report, this quarter, the application of materials a total increase of $1.3 billion, the total backlog reached a huge $ 8 billion. This also indicates that namely, the company is close to selling out its capacity in 2022.

 

According to a report in the Securities Times, in the compound semiconductor sector, the upstream key MOCVD equipment is affected by the tight supply of parts and delivery lead time is extended again, with the latest need to about 10 months.

 

It can be said that almost all of the equipment delivery time has been extended. The battle for semiconductor equipment has long been fought, customers have placed orders in advance, the order backlog has been the industry norm. Last year, basically all semiconductor equipment suppliers have made a lot of money. For example, in 2021, ASML shipped 286 lithography machines, creating revenue of 18.6 billion euros, of which only the EUV lithography machine reached 42 units. Other manufacturers can specifically see the "earn to the hands of the semiconductor equipment manufacturers". According to SEMI forecast, in 2021 and 2022 global semiconductor equipment sales will reach 95.3 and 101.3 billion U.S. dollars, an increase of 34.1% and 6.3% year-on-year.


Not only grab new equipment, used equipment is even more “fragrant”


At the moment, both foundries and IDM manufacturers, and even some Fabless companies are expanding production, building factories, and maturing nodes in a major direction. But if you want to expand the production capacity of old chips, these buyers will have to face a difficult choice: either to enter the long waiting cycle for new equipment, the major equipment manufacturers have no signs of shortening the delivery time; or to buy old used equipment, but used equipment is now also in short supply.

 

In fact, demand for both new and used equipment for manufacturing chips has been growing since 2016. The extended delivery period for new equipment has directly pushed up the price and volume of used equipment, and the refurbished delivery price of some used equipment has approached or even exceeded that of new machines. The current market of used semiconductor equipment trading can be described as "quantity and price increase". For example, the Canon FPA3000i4, a 1995 lithography machine used to etch circuits on chips, was valued at $100,000 in October 2014 but has now risen to $1.7 million.


Last year's automotive chip shortage made us realize that most of the chips in the products we use are made with older manufacturing techniques, with many being produced on used equipment. Bruce Kim, CEO of SurplusGLOBAL, has stated that the company has recycled 40,000 tools in the last 20 years.

 

It is not only such as applied materials, KLA and other large manufacturers of semiconductor equipment last year to make money hand over fist. According to Chen Zhen, general manager of SurplusGLOBAL China, the world's leading used semiconductor equipment vendor, told Semiconductor Industry Insight, "SurplusGLOBAL is close to doubling its global sales in 2021 compared to 2020, and doubling its sales in China. The reason for such a large volume of used semiconductor equipment, the advantage is mainly reflected in the short delivery time above."
